Kate and William, both 37, are very familiar with royal christenings — all three of their children have been the center of their own in recent years.

George’s christeningoccurred in late October(more than three months after he was born) at the Chapel Royal in London’s St. James’s Palace. Charlotte’s was held two months after her birth at the St. Mary Magdalene Church in Norfolk,on the grounds of the Queen’s Sandringham estate— and very close to William and Kate’s country home, Anmer Hall.

Louis was christenedat the same place as his older brother in July 2018, about three months after his world debut. The event was also special because it marked the first time the world saw Kate and William as a family of five!
